Champions League RO16 Day 8!


[image loading] Borussia Dortmund de vs [image loading] Zenit st. Petersburg ru

+ Show Spoiler [1st Leg] +
[image loading] Zenit st. Petersburg ru 2 - 4 [image loading] Borussia Dortmund de

+ Show Spoiler [2nd Leg] +
[image loading] Borussia Dortmund de vs [image loading] Zenit st. Petersburg ru

+ Show Spoiler [Overall Result] +
x wins 0-0 on Aggregate and Advance to RO8!


[image loading] Team News
Sven Bender sustained a groin injury on 22 February and could be out for ten weeks. Marco Reus, who has missed the last two games with a muscular problem, is "feeling well" but will not be in the squad. "He could run today, he has no pain, but he could not participate in full team training," said Klopp.

[image loading] Team News
Cristian Ansaldi (muscle) and Andrey Arshavin (hamstring) have stayed in Russia. Third-choice goalkeeper Egor Baburin is ruled out by a knee ligament problem.



[image loading] Manchester United [image loading] vs [image loading] Olympiacos gr

+ Show Spoiler [1st Leg] +
[image loading] Olympiacos gr 2 - 0 [image loading] Manchester United [image loading]

+ Show Spoiler [2nd Leg] +
[image loading] Manchester United [image loading] 0-0 [image loading] Olympiacos gr

+ Show Spoiler [Overall Result] +
x wins 0-0 on Aggregate and Advance to RO8!


[image loading] Team News
Jonny Evans (calf) has not played since 1 February. Chris Smalling (hamstring), Javier Hernández (knee) and Nani (hamstring) are also on the sidelines.

[image loading] Team News
Javier Saviola (quadriceps) and Iván Marcano (calf) resumed normal training at the end of last week and have travelled to Manchester. Michael Olaitan (viral myocarditis) is ruled out, together with long-time absentee Dimitris Siovas (broken ankle). Leandro Salino, Kostas Manolas and Delvin N'Dinga were rested on Saturday.
